The course objective is for students to learn how to conduct financial studies empirically. This course deals with how to go from theoretical problems to how these can be empirically investigated. Major focus of the course is on financial econometrics and time series analysis and the synthesis from empirical analysis. The course also deals with what happens when we let go of the assumption of full rationality of the individual and thus the market and methods for investigating this.
